COACHELLA 2022 TURNS TO RAGE

August 2, 2021 by Traci Turner

After a move from 2020 to 2021, and then landing on 2022, the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ival has announced its headliners for next year and beyond.
When the massive festival returns, Rage Against the Machine and Travis Scott will headline, with a third headliner still to be announced. Coachella also announced the headliner for 2023 will be Frank Ocean.
Rock and Roll Hall of Fame nominees Rage Against the Machine reunited in late 2019 for a world tour, which got postponed for the usual 2020 reason. They plan to resume in March 2022.
Travis Scott released the single “Franchise” in the fall of 2020 and he debuted new songs at Rolling Loud last month. His new album “Utopia” is due out soon.
Goldenvoice head honcho Paul Tollett told the Los Angeles Times the Coachella news was being announced early to offer hope to the fans after the pandemic canceled so much of our lives.
“Right now, it’s the Wild West,” he told the LA Times. “I’m just trying to be as fair as I can to artists and to the fans to make sure that eventually they get to see everyone that we talked about.”
